ADODB(ActiveX Data Objects)是微软提供的一组用于访问数据库的组件,广泛应用于VB、VBA以及ASP等开发环境中。在操作Access数据库时,ADODB能够提供高效的数据读取和写入功能。
使用ADODB连接Access数据库时,通常需要构建一个连接字符串。例如,使用Jet OLEDB提供程序,连接字符串可以写成\"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=数据库路径;\"。对于较新的Access版本,建议使用\"Provider=Microsoft.ACE.OLEDB.12.0;\"。
在执行SQL查询时,应尽量避免使用通配符“”,而是明确指定所需字段,这样可以减少数据传输量并提高查询效率。同时,合理使用索引也能显著提升查询速度。
对于批量数据操作,如插入或更新多条记录,应考虑使用批处理方式。通过将多个操作组合成一个事务,可以减少与数据库的交互次数,从而提升性能。
AI绘图结果,仅供参考
在代码中及时关闭记录集和连接对象是良好的编程习惯,这有助于释放系统资源并避免内存泄漏。•对异常进行捕获和处理,能有效提高程序的稳定性和用户体验。